Description
-------

When a masquerade occurs, a newly created channel replaces an existing channel 
and steals its private data structure. This includes swapping the formats and 
capabilities.

Since the newly created channel only contains ast_format_none, this causes an 
assert to fire when the masqueraded channel is destroyed.

Removing the assert isn't a good idea. However, there's also no real need to do 
the accessing that fires the asserts either: the masqueraded channel will be 
destroyed, the references will be cleaned up appropriately, and life will go 
on. free_translation is also called in a channel destructor, and again, things 
will be cleaned up appropriately without going through the accessors that have 
the asserts.
